Is the Bitcoin cycle dead, or are we just getting started? With Bitcoin hovering around $92K and institutional adoption accelerating, the crypto landscape is more confusing—and exciting—than ever. Robert and Will break down the wild crypto year of 2024-2025 and debate what's coming in 2026. They explain the GENIUS Act that ended the "Biden war on crypto," why stablecoins could drive down costs across the economy (0.3% fees vs 3-10% traditional payments), and how companies like Visa are building crypto payment rails. But it's not all bullish. They dive into the Japan carry trade unwinding, the dangers of government-controlled CBDCs, and the big question: Is this Bitcoin cycle over or just delayed? Will argues we're in a lengthening cycle driven by global liquidity. Robert thinks the blow-off top is behind us and October 2026 will be the next buying opportunity. They also preview the Clarity Act coming in Q1 2026, which could open the floodgates for institutional investment in the broader crypto space beyond just stablecoins.
